GRANDMA PRENTICE'S CHILI SAUCE



Grandma Prentice's Chili Sauce image

Old family recipe. Great for topping on eggs or just about any sandwich.

Time 7h30m

Yield 112

Number Of Ingredients 11

25 tomatoes, chopped
10 onions, cut into chunks
1 quart apple cider vinegar
6 green bell peppers, seeded and chopped
5 chile peppers, seeded and chopped
1 ½ cups white sugar
1 green chile pepper, chopped with the seeds
1 tablespoon salt
1 teaspoon ground allspice
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ground cloves

Steps:

  • Mix tomatoes, onions, apple cider vinegar, green bell peppers, seeded chopped chile peppers, sugar, unseeded chopped chile pepper, salt, allspice, cinnamon, and cloves together in a large mixing bowl.
  • Ladle enough of the tomato mixture into the pitcher of a blender to fill to about 3/4-full; blend until smooth. Pour blended mixture into a large pot. Repeat blending until entire mixture has been pureed.
  • Bring the mixture to a boil, reduce heat to medium-low, and simmer until thickened, 7 to 8 hours.

GRANDMA'S CHILI SAUCE



Grandma's Chili Sauce image

This is the chili sauce my grandma used to make, then my mom, and now me. It is so good, it would be illegal not to share it.

Time 1h35m

Yield 14 Quarts

Number Of Ingredients 8

10 liters tomatoes (Peeled)
1 1/2 kg brown sugar
2 cups onions, finely chopped
3 -4 green peppers, finely chopped
1/2 cup pickling salt
1 liter malt vinegar (5 % acetic acid)
1/2-1 stalk celery, finely chopped
3 ounces pickling spices

Steps:

  • Wash jars well, and dry in 200 oven for 10 minute.
  • Put Pickling spices into cheesecloth, and make a bag, tie top well, and leave several inches of sting. Tie to handle of pot.
  • In 15 liter heavy duty pot , add all ingredients, and bring to boil, then reduce to simmer.
  • Simmer for 1 - 1 1/2 hours until celery is soft, stirring often. Remove spice bags.
  • Ladle into Jars, put lids on and allow to seal.

GRANDMA'S CHILI



Grandma's Chili image

This is a hand-me-down from my Grandma. I like it because it doesn't have kidney beans and it has a bit of a sweet taste. It's a brown chili not a red one - no tomatoes.

Time 1h15m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 pounds ground beef
½ onion, chopped
½ green bell pepper, chopped
salt and pepper to taste
1 (15 ounce) can baked beans
1 (4.5 ounce) can mushrooms, drained
1 tablespoon brown sugar
¼ teaspoon chili powder

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an over medium high heat, saute the ground beef for 5 minutes, or until browned. Stir in the onion and green bell pepper and saute for 5 more minutes.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Next, add the beans, mushrooms, brown sugar and chili powder to taste. Mix together well, reduce heat to low and let simmer for 20 minutes to 1 hour or more, depending on how much time you have and how thick you like your chili.

GRANDMOTHER'S CHILI SAUCE



Grandmother's Chili Sauce image

Pamela R. says this is an old family recipe passed down from her southern grandmother. It is a traditional old south condiment served with all kinds of meat (especially great on top of meatloaf). A good homemade chili sauce has chunks of tomatoes and a rich burgundy color.This is a medium spice level, but you can add more or leave out entirely. Traditionally it's used with fresh tomatoes, but the recipe was converted to use canned tomatoes years ago. You can store this in the refrigerator for several weeks. I found this very quick and easy to make and the flavors are outstanding. Serving size is estimated. YUM!

Time 35m

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

29 ounces diced tomatoes
1 cup sugar
2/3 cup apple cider vinegar
1 cup onion, chopped
3 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ground ginger
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 teaspoons cayenne pepper

Steps:

  • Mix all dry ingredients in a large saucepan.
  • Add the vinegar; tomatoes, and onions; mix well.
  • Bring to a boil over medium heat.
  • Continue to cook, uncovered until it is reduced by half.
  • Cool.
  • Cover tightly and store in the refrigerator.
